The biggest nightmare of California's largest utility companies may be about to begin playing out, thanks to a small irrigation district in San Joaquin County and a bunch of disgruntled customers of Pacific Gas & Electric Co. This trend also had help from the state's voters, who in 2010 rejected a ballot proposition designed and written to prevent such a day from ever coming, a measure on which PG&E squandered about $35 million.
